Output 67aae5aa7517709a9d66544efad6170e711905933eecfe2348d48985b1a4993f:13

value
170490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ba47c99667333a3c1406a284bca8560a8db44db OP_EQUAL
address
35fn2XgbTXpezsvzgh7BRTfy8WQzsxtmEq
transaction
67aae5aa7517709a9d66544efad6170e711905933eecfe2348d48985b1a4993f
confirmations
257184
spent
true